Estonia - Educational expenditure in lower secondary

15.0 (%) in 2011

Educational expenditure in lower secondary as % of total educational expenditure is the percentage of public education expenditure for lower secondary education. Public expenditure (current and capital) includes government spending on educational institutions (both public and private) and education administration as well as subsidies for private entities (students/households and other privates entities). In some instances data on public expenditure on education refers only to the ministry of education, excluding other ministries that spend a part of their budget on educational activities at a given level of education.

Date Value Change, %
2011 15.0 -7.09%
2010 16.1 -4.94%
2009 16.9 -8.69%
2008 18.5 1.44%
2007 18.3 -12.78%
2005 21.0 -12.12%
2004 23.9 1.91%
2003 23.4 3.20%
2002 22.7 3.99%
2001 21.8 23.52%
1999 17.7 18.77%
1998 14.9
